Ludwig Von 2 posted...
See there is so much competition that Id think itd be the opposite. You wanna stay alive you gotta cut prices.

But there is a price floor at which point the store would be losing money to push product. The lowest you're ever going to get is that price floor plus whatever overhead is required to run the store causing it to break even. The rare exception is when you have a mega-corporation that is intentionally taking a loss to push out smaller businesses who can afford a sustained loss as well.

As the cost of food itself goes up because of reduced production, food stores have no choice but to raise their prices as well. And keep in mind that a sustained run at only breaking even means that there is no hiring, no sales, no pay raises, no overtime, Etc.
